Throttle body relearn
Am i able to clean the throttle bodies one day then do the procedures the next morning due to the heat so my coolant is cold enough or do i have to do all within the same day or pretty close apart

If I'm not mistaken, you are supposed to bring the engine up to normal operating temperature prior to performing the TB relearn. Make sure all accessories are off, too.

From what i came across i think its the second part of the procedure that the coolant temp has to be below 77°f, after that then the car needs to be at normal operating temp to finish the procedure. I could for sure be wrong though. That being said i just wanted to know if i can clean the tb's today then leave it till the morning to do the procedure so i can achieve that below 77°f temp, being that its pretty hot these days

For the TB Closed Position Learning procedure, it does note for the engine to be cooled before warming up. The Idle Air Learning procedure also has a specific temp range.
